About Dharmkot

Dharmkot is a small city in India (Punjab) with a population of 19,057. The city sits at an elevation of 728 feet (222 meters) above sea level. The average annual temperature is 74°F (24°C). Temperatures range from 54°F in January to 87°F in July. Annual precipitation averages 22.2 inches. The timezone is Asia/Kolkata.

Dharmkot has a population of 19,057 with a density of 74 people per square mile, spread across 257.9 square miles. The median age is 30.0 years, 23% younger than the national median of 38.9.

Climate in Dharmkot

Dharmkot has an average annual temperature of 24.8°C (77°F). The hottest month is Jun (36°C), the coldest is Jan (11.6°C). Average annual precipitation is 826 mm.

Month Avg °C / °F Min / Max °C Rain (mm)
Jan 11.6°C / 53°F 2° / 22.4° 41.4
Feb 15.8°C / 60°F 3.7° / 28.2° 21.9
Mar 21.6°C / 71°F 8.9° / 36.3° 38.1
Apr 28.1°C / 83°F 14.6° / 41.5° 19.4
May 33.3°C / 92°F 20.2° / 47° 31.0
Jun 36°C / 97°F 24.6° / 46.5° 65.3
Jul 33.2°C / 92°F 26.1° / 43.7° 248.5
Aug 30.7°C / 87°F 24.2° / 38.1° 202.2
Sep 29.4°C / 85°F 21.8° / 37.3° 106.5
Oct 25.1°C / 77°F 15.2° / 35.5° 27.9
Nov 19.2°C / 67°F 9.2° / 31.5° 14.0
Dec 13.7°C / 57°F 2.6° / 26° 10.0

Earthquake History

12 earthquakes (M2.5+) within 150 km since 1990. Strongest: M4.6. Most recent: M4.2 on Jan 4, 2023.

Feb 21, 2014 18 km ESE of Dirba, India M4.6 138 km
Jul 17, 2016 7 km ESE of Kahna Nau, Pakistan M4.5 87 km
Mar 14, 2010 4 km ENE of Gagret, India M4.5 116 km
Nov 6, 2013 9 km NE of Gagret, India M4.4 122 km
Aug 29, 2013 1 km NNE of Una, India M4.4 115 km
Jan 4, 2023 1 km SSW of Shekhupura, Pakistan M4.2 146 km
Jan 27, 2002 11 km NNW of Khem Karan, India M4.2 76 km
Feb 15, 2005 3 km ESE of Fatehgarh Ch?ri?n, India M4.2 103 km
Aug 13, 1997 14 km SSW of Bilaspur, India M4.2 142 km
Nov 30, 1995 7 km ENE of Shekhupura, Pakistan M4.1 141 km
Feb 3, 2002 11 km SSE of Nankana Sahib, Pakistan M3.7 149 km
Apr 9, 2008 27 km WSW of Amritsar, India M3.3 83 km
Source: USGS (M2.5+, 1990-2025)
